Norway is more popular than you think

Yes, it is true.
Of the top of your head, I bet you can say that Norway is Scandinavian (true!) and that the people speak Norwegian (also true!), and maybe that the country is famous for fjords (correctomundo).
But let's dig deeper.




Did you know that the band who sings "What does the fox say?" is Norwegian?
Or that visits to Norway picked up after the Disney movie Frozen hit the general populace? The look of Frozen was based, after all, on Norway.




Or that the film How to Train your Dragon, though without any particular location base, is still following the Norwegian Vikings (pronounced vee-kings in Norsk) and still shows the fog, rain, and mountains pretty accurately.

Or that the Nobel Peace Prize is presented by the Nobel Peace Center in Oslo (the capital of Norway).




Or that trolls come from Norse mythology



And let's not forget the rest of Norse mythology: Odin, Thor, Valhalla, etc. 

You know this stuff.

See, you are smarter than you think.
